Advantages Offered by the Product
Enhanced Enzyme Activity Control
Ferric Sodium EDTA effectively eliminates enzyme inhibition caused by trace heavy metals, ensuring optimal performance in biochemical processes. This is crucial for applications where EDTA FeNa enzyme inhibition needs to be precisely managed.
Targeted Pest Management
As a potent molluscicide, it aids in controlling snails and slugs with chemicals by disrupting their hemocyanin, providing an efficient solution for agricultural pest control.
Improved Plant Nutrition
The chelated iron form ensures efficient absorption by plants, making it an excellent source of micronutrients, supporting the concept of chelated iron for plants for better crop yields.
Key Applications
Agriculture & Horticulture
Utilized as a source of chelated iron for plants, improving nutrient availability and addressing iron deficiencies, crucial for sustainable agriculture and maximizing crop yields.
Pest Control
Acts as a molluscicide to effectively control snail and slug populations, preventing damage to crops and gardens by disrupting their physiological processes.
Industrial Processes
Employed as an industrial chelating agent to manage metal ions in various processes, preventing unwanted reactions and ensuring product stability.
Research & Development
A valuable compound for laboratory research, particularly in studying enzyme kinetics and the effects of metal ions on biological systems.
